The Lubavitcher Rebbe called for the founding of a central institution to support Shluchim in 5747 (1987), a revolutionary idea at the time. Since then, The Shluchim Office has established a thirty-year history of impactful projects and was the impetus behind the founding of many more institutions that today offer assistance to Shluchim.
This year alone, The Shluchim Office has helped Shluchim and their families thousands of times, through Networking, Hospitality in Crown Heights, The Nigri Shluchim Online School, the Shluchim Gemach, CYH – Connecting Young Shluchim, Friendship Circle International, and many other flagship programs.
The Shluchim Office also serves as a home-away-from-home for Shluchim visiting New York, providing a lounge facility offering workspace, refreshment and relaxation when a Shliach visits New York, and the Pomegranate Suites for lodging while they visit.
